## Onboarding: StockTally Reconciliation Job

Welcome to the support rotation. The StockTally job runs nightly at 02:15 and compares warehouse counts from the Binward scanner feed against the Ledgerline inventory service. When counts diverge beyond the tolerance threshold, it opens a discrepancy ticket automatically — you'll triage those each morning. To re-run the job manually or inspect its state, you'll call the internal Ledgerline admin API, which authenticates with a single scoped key shared by the support team. That key is provided here:

API key for tagef-tafop: kto11_0R87lsya3Bn

CHANGELOG — Bramblewick build migration (hermetic toolchain). Renamed setting: BW_BUILD_CACHE_URL is now HERMETIC_CACHE_ENDPOINT. Old name is dead as of release 4.2; builds referencing it fail fast with exit 78. On-call: if the nightly pipeline stalls at the fetch phase, the runner is still reading the legacy env file. Regenerate it from template v3, confirm the renamed key is present, and restart the runner daemon. The cache endpoint also requires its access token on the next line of the env file.

secret setting of hawep-yahig: LEDGER_TOKEN29=41b5d6315371c92885eaeb077fb63

Subject: Key rotation — Greenvane controller telemetry

Hi,

As part of this week's release, we are rotating the credential used by the Greenvane greenhouse controller to report telemetry. Background: the humidity sensors in Bay 3 have been drifting roughly 4% per week, and the recalibration patch requires the controller to push correction tables to the Mistral calibration service. The old key will be revoked Friday at noon. Please update the deployment secrets with the replacement key immediately below.

gateway credential: vxb11-v9yOsaxubAz

Subject: DR drill — Friday, Pickwise optimizer

Team, this Friday we're running a disaster-recovery drill on Pickwise, the warehouse pick-list optimizer behind the Carrowfield sites. Expect the optimizer to go read-only for about an hour; pickers will fall back to static route sheets, so log any customer reports under the drill tag rather than as incidents. Support leads will restore the standby instance from the sealed backup, which unlocks with the passphrase below.

recovery phrase for fajep-yaweg: gilath-sorox-wenius-rusdor-keliel-zorius